Interesting reading the criticisms of the Tessa/sex ring story.

 

A lot of complaints about it being about a new character.

 

Thinking back to the unwed mother story of the 80s that introduced Nina to the canvas.

 

I wonder if there were similar complaints?

 

I guess the difference was that it was just one story in the midst of other strong plots(not happening today) Also Tricia Cast delivered so audience took to her (not happening this time)
